What is automation rate in SAP BPI-PI - SAP Process Insights?


SAP Term: automation rate

  • Component: BPI-PI

  • Component Name: SAP Process Insights

  • Description: The percentage of business objects that were processed automatically in a given timeframe. This metric can be used to determine the ratio of business documents that were processed manually instead of automatically and helps highlight opportunities for performance improvement.
